Stack for the second social studies vocab quiz of 2016

Social Darwinism   “Survival of the fittest:” the belief that the people who are rich and powerful are there because they proved themselves and deserve to be there, and the same for those who are poor.

Stock   Shares of ownership in a corporation

Stock market   The market in which shares of publicly held companies are issued and traded either through exchanges or over-the-counter markets.

Stockholder/Shareholder   The owner of stock (a piece of a corporation)

Corporation   A group legally organized to act and to have its own rights separate from those of its members; a company in which the owners hold shares of stock and the firm has a separate legal identity from its owners.

Monopoly   Dominance in or control of a market for certain goods or services by a single company or combination of companies

Free Enterprise   An economic system where few restrictions are placed on business activities and ownership and where governments generally have minimal ownership of enterprises in the market place.
